200

You are reading the ingredients on a loaf of bread, and the first ingredient says "wheat". It is a whole grain. True or False?

False. We can't determine whether a food is a whole grain just by the name. We have to look for whole grains (e.g. whole wheat, whole corn, etc.) as the first ingredient on the ingredient list.

300

On a nutrition facts label, you will see "total sugars" and "added sugars." How are they different?

Total sugars include both naturally occurring sugars and added sugars. Added sugars are sugars that are added to a product when it is manufactured.

400

On our nutrition facts label, which nutrients should we consume less of (less healthy)?

Which should we consume more of (more healthy)?

Less: Saturated fat, sodium, added sugars; aim for no trans fat

More: Dietary Fiber, Vitamin D, Calcium, Iron, and Potassium.

400

True or False: You should compare total prices of items to be sure you're getting the best deal.

False: You want to compare unit prices to make sure you compare "apples to apples" or find the lowest cost per unit.

500

You only have one cutting board. You need to use it to cut both the vegetables and the raw meat. What should you do?

Cut the veggies first, than transfer them to another dish before cutting the meat.

 Or cut the meat first, then wash and sanitize the cutting board thoroughly before cutting the vegetables.
